Top Summer Programmes: Simons Summer Research Program

Ivy Central

What makes Simons stand out from other STEM research summer programmes is that Simons Fellows (accepted students) can choose to identify a member of faculty who is conducting research into an area they are interested in and ask them to act as their mentor for the duration of the program.

Top Summer Programmes: Boston University’s Research in Science & Engineering (RISE)

Ivy Central

Internship Track: If you choose the Internship track you will have the opportunity to work on research projects for 40 hours per week with distinguished faculty, postdoctoral fellows, and graduate students.
